Position Summary

Seeking an Operations Manager to oversee operational systems and events management for two funder collaboratives with small teams and large networks. Census Equity Initiative (CEI) is a national funder collaborative promoting a fair and accurate count on the decennial census and the American Community Survey. Fair Representation in Redistricting (FRR) is a national funder collaborative promoting fair districts. Both collaboratives are projects of New Venture Fund. The Operations Manager time on each project will likely shift based on need but will be roughly two-thirds for CEI and one-third for FRR. This is a unique opportunity to support two dynamic teams who coordinate with philanthropy and field leaders to improve our democracy. (Overviews of the collaboratives are available here).

Compensation and Benefits

Salary range: The salary range for this position is $70,000 – $90,000, commensurate with experience.

Benefits: Comprehensive benefits package that includes 100% employer-paid health, dental, and vision insurance for employees (and their families). Employees are able to enroll in 401(k) retirement plan, and are eligible for a 3% automatic contribution and up to a 3% employer match on 401k contributions. Employees are also eligible for pre-tax transportation benefits. Employees will receive 80 hours of vacation time, 80 hours of health leave, up to 2 days of casual leave, and 20 hours of volunteer leave annually. Employees will also receive 13 paid holidays throughout the calendar year. Employees are eligible for 12 weeks of paid family and medical leave after 90 days of employment.
